Lake Jocassee is a 7,500-acre (30 km ), 300-foot (91 m) deep reservoir in northwest South Carolina. The Jocassee Dam, which forms the lake, is 385 feet (117m) high and 1,750 feet (530m) long. Jocassee Lake offers great fishing for Largemouth Bass, Smallmouth Bass, Spotted Bass, White Bass, Hybrid Striped Bass, Rainbow Trout, Brown Trout, Black Crappie, White Crappie, Bluegill, Redear Sunfish, Pumpkinseed Sunfish, Yellow Perch, Chain Pickerel, Channel Catfish and Flathead Catfish. Jocassee was a beautiful Cherokee girl who fell in love with a boy from an enemy tribe, the Eastatoees, known as the Green Birds, who lived on the other side of the river that separated them. Although most manmade structures were demolished before the lake was flooded, divers recently discovered the remains of a lodge that was left intact; it is now below 300 feet (91m) of water. Legend has it that Jocassee went into the water and did not sink but walked across the water to meet the ghost of Nagoochee.
